Here’s our super long list of paleo and primal food in Australia.
Paleo and Primal Australia wide
Tip – Just ask your local butcher if the meat is grass fed? And how it is finished? We were surprised to find grass fed meat is often not advertised.

Adelaide and South Australia
- Meat – organic/grass-fed etc: P&O organic butchers, located in the city in the David Jones basement in Food Glorious Food, and also on Magill Road. The Magill Road one is far more useful if you are looking for the more ‘uncommon’ parts of meat.
- Coconut Oil – available in several places in and around the Central Market, but for the best value/selection I go to Goodies and Grains in the Central Markets (Gouger St side).
- Coconut Flour – order it through the health food store in Burnside Village.
- Spices/nuts/dutch pressed cocoa/agave nectar – Goodies and Grains in Central Market

Melbourne and Victoria
- Supplements and stock Wicked Whey (choc) and Naked Whey (unflavoured), which are good, clean, locally-made, grass-fed whey protein products – Great Earth
- Kefir – Polish deli at Vic Market
- Rendina’s Butchery in Balwyn stock a huge range of organic, bio-dynamic and free-range meats, including homemade smallgoods (and are lovely people).
- The Vic Market is great with loads of super fresh organic veggies, nuts and spices, and the Chicken Pantry in the shop section sells free range and some organic poultry and game. McIntosh’s sell organic coffee beans.
- Cherry Tree Organics in Beaconsfield are butchers selling their own organic/bio-dynamic lamb and beef as well as pork, chicken and smallgoods. They also have vegetables and some fruit and order bath milk for anyone who likes to take milk baths. They also stock True Organic butter and cheeses.
- I get coconut flour, flakes, and a couple of different brands of oil from Go Vita Berwick
